Jalousie window replacement services involve removing old or damaged jalousie windows and installing new units that provide improved functionality and appearance. These windows typically consist of multiple horizontal glass slats that open and close using a crank or lever mechanism. Replacing a jalousie window can help enhance a home's ventilation, natural light, and overall curb appeal. Skilled service providers ensure the new windows are properly fitted and operate smoothly, offering homeowners a seamless upgrade to their existing window systems.

This service is particularly useful for resolving common problems associated with aging jalousie windows. Over time, the glass slats may become cracked, foggy, or difficult to open and close. The window frames can also warp or become damaged, leading to drafts, leaks, or security concerns. Replacing these windows can significantly improve energy efficiency by reducing air leaks and drafts, as well as eliminating issues caused by broken or malfunctioning hardware. For homeowners experiencing difficulty with their current jalousie windows, professional replacement offers a practical solution.

Properties that often benefit from jalousie window replacement include older homes, especially those built in the mid-20th century, as well as vacation homes, sunrooms, and patios. These windows are popular in regions with warm or breezy climates because they facilitate good airflow. However, when they become worn or inefficient, they can compromise comfort and security. The overview below groups typical Jalousie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prescott Valley,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or jalousie window repairs, such as replacing louvers or seals,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Partial Replacement - Replacing individual panels or hardware usually ranges from $600 to $1,200. Local contractors often complete these projects efficiently within this middle tier.

Full Window Replacement - Installing a new jalousie window can cost between $1,200 and $2,500 for standard sizes. Larger or custom-sized windows may push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.

Complete System Overhaul - For extensive upgrades or multiple windows, costs can reach $3,000 to $5,000 or more. These larger projects are less common but are handled by experienced service providers in the area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
